Ignore:
Timestamp:
12/11/18 13:22:07 (6 years ago)
Author:
oabramkina
Message:

Exception handling on trunk.

To activate it, compilation flag -DXIOS_EXCEPTION should be added.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• XIOS/trunk/src/transformation/axis_algorithm_zoom.cpp

    r1559 r1622  
    1919                                                           std::map<int, int>& elementPositionInGridDst2AxisPosition, 
    2020                                                           std::map<int, int>& elementPositionInGridDst2DomainPosition) 
     21TRY 
    2122{ 
    2223  std::vector<CAxis*> axisListDestP = gridDst->getAxis(); 
     
    2930  return (new CAxisAlgorithmZoom(axisListDestP[axisDstIndex], axisListSrcP[axisSrcIndex], zoomAxis)); 
    3031} 
     32CATCH 
     33 
    3134bool CAxisAlgorithmZoom::registerTrans() 
     35TRY 
    3236{ 
    3337  CGridTransformationFactory<CAxis>::registerTransformation(TRANS_ZOOM_AXIS, create); 
    3438} 
     39CATCH 
    3540 
    3641CAxisAlgorithmZoom::CAxisAlgorithmZoom(CAxis* axisDestination, CAxis* axisSource, CZoomAxis* zoomAxis) 
    3742: CAxisAlgorithmTransformation(axisDestination, axisSource) 
     43TRY 
    3844{ 
    3945  zoomAxis->checkValid(axisSource); 
     
    104110  } 
    105111} 
     112CATCH 
    106113 
    107114/*! 
Note: See TracChangeset for help on using the changeset viewer.